Tips for Drivers to protect Pedestrians:
- Do not park on the sidewalk or block the crosswalk.
- Make sure to follow traffic rules.
- Stay alert at all times while driving, especially for pedestrians who may be walking alongside the road or crossing, especially where there's a crosswalk; give them the right of way.
- Avoid being distracted by your phone, playing music too loudly, or engaging with other passengers while driving.
- Respect pedestrians' rights: Yield to pedestrians at crosswalks and intersections where there's a crosswalk, and obey speed limits.
- Exercise caution when approaching areas where there may be more pedestrians present, such as schools, commercial establishments, and residential areas.
- When approaching a crosswalk or roundabout, reduce speed and be more attentive to pedestrians and cyclists.
- Avoid driving if you've consumed alcohol or drugs.
